PTI chief fails to submit response before ECP
by DNA

ISLAMABAD: Pakistan Tehreeke Insaf (PTI) Chairman Imran Khan failed to submit his response before the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P) on Thursday in foreign funding case looking for his disqualification from Member of National Assembly (MNA) seat.

Chief Election Commissioner (CEC) of Pakistan Sardar Muhammad Raza responded to PTI chief’s council’s allegations of harsh behaviour of ECP towards their leader dismissing them by saying that Khan has not submitted his response to the commission in two and a half years.

It is pertinent to mention that CEC stated on Tuesday that final verdict of the case would be announced on July 10 in contempt of court case.
